Batch Renaming Pictures and File Format Extensions |
|||||||||||||||||||||||||||||||||||||
Batch renaming pictures does not change file extensions, so you can rename a mixture of BMP, GIF, JPEG, PCX, and TIFF files at the same time without changing the picture formats. |

Batch Renaming 1 Picture File |
|||||||||||||||||||||||||||||||||||||
Attempting to [Rename]
a selection of files will force the [Batch Rename] function and you will
be presented with the [Batch Rename] dialog. The reverse is not true, i.e.
Batch renaming a single file will still display the [Batch Rename] dialog.
